Hello!

I thought I might ask here since there are many anki lovers.

I want to create a deck that has

- three field cards: Italian, English, explanation (with the last two being unveiled only after the specific action)
- the reverse of the above card, so English, Italian, explanation (with the last two being unveiled only after the specific action)
- audio for Italian

Looking for quick ways to do this, especially the audio.

At the moment I have built something on Excel. I write cards on three columns and the English+explanation is effectively the back of the card with a fancy
———————
in the middle. I then mix them to obtain the English, Italian+explanation.

I upload on Anki and record audio, but being I, E+exp and E, I+exp two different cards (i.e. the latter is not really the back of the former, otherwise I'd have E+exp, I), I have to record the same audio twice. a bit time consuming.

Looking for quicker ways to do this.

What I do for audio is record a whole set of words in a single run in Audacity - then put labels and export. You can then edit a deck and just drag and drop the recordings into the audio field.

To create cards where the reverse is different from the front, just go to Tools / Manage Note Types and clone the "Basic and Reverse" Note Type - edit this and apply it to your deck. The fields and front and back for going in one direction do not have to match going in the other direction.

zenmonkey has covered just about everything, but in case it's helpful, here's an example of what your cards might look like...

Sounds like for each note you'll need four fields, which we could call Italian, English, Explanation, and Audio (of course, you could use any names). And for each note you'll need two cards, which we could call Forward and Reverse. As zenmonkey said, these don't actually have to mirror one other.

Your Forward card might look something like this...

Front:

Code: Select all

{{Audio}}
{{Italian}}

Back:

Code: Select all

{{FrontSide}}
<hr>
{{English}}
<br>
{{Explanation}}

Or if you didn't want to hear the audio again when flipping the card, you could change the first line on the back from {{FrontSide}} to {{Italian}}.

And your Reverse card might look something like this...

Front:

Code: Select all

{{English}}

Back:

Code: Select all

{{FrontSide}}
<hr>
{{Audio}}
{{Italian}}
<br>
{{Explanation}}

You'd probably want to make some adjustments to the above, but just wanted to give you a rough idea of how you could do it.
